Senior Software Engineer
Description
Role Summary
What You'll Get to Do
- Build robust, fault-tolerant distributed systems in a multi-threaded/multi-process environment.
- Analyze and improve scalability of storing, routing, and searching data at scale.
- Identify and resolve bottlenecks in distributed systems, data pipelines, and multi-threaded performance.
- Mentor team members in performance, scalability, and quality strategies.
- Collaborate in a CI/CD development model for cloud-native deployments.
- Drive development, delivery, and ongoing engineering hygiene.
- Work closely with an amazing team and collaborate with a global engineering organization.
Must-Have Qualifications
- 8+ years of related experience with a technical Bachelor’s degree; or equivalent practical experience.
- Extensive experience developing software using C++, Python, GoLang, or other object-oriented programming languages
- Proven experience crafting and building scalable software, with expertise in cloud environments and knowledge of continuous delivery, security practices, and performance optimization.
- Skilled in problem-solving, identifying performance bottlenecks, and resolving product outages.
- Strong communication skills, both verbal and written.
- Eagerness to learn and adapt in a dynamic environment with multiple ongoing projects.
Nice-to-Have Qualifications
- Proficiency with Kubernetes and related tooling.
- Hands-on experience with Terraform.
- Experience with AWS, particularly in maintaining production environments using Aurora PostgreSQL, SQS, and S3.
- Familiarity with GCP or Azure cloud platforms.
- Knowledge of Puppet and configuration management practices.
Note:
Base Pay Range
Poland
Base Pay: PLN 248,000.00 - 341,000.00 per year
Splunk provides flexibility and choice in the working arrangement for most roles, including remote and/or in-office roles. We have a market-based pay structure which varies by location. Please note that the base pay range is a guideline and for candidates who receive an offer, the base pay will vary based on factors such as work location as set out above, as well as the knowledge, skills and experience of the candidate. In addition to base pay, this role is eligible for incentive compensation and may be eligible for equity or long-term cash awards.
Benefits are an important part of Splunk's Total Rewards package. This role is eligible for a comprehensive, competitive benefits package which may include healthcare and retirement plans, paid time off, wellbeing expense reimbursement, and much more! Learn more about our next-level benefits at https://splunkbenefits.com.
Thank you for your interest in Splunk!